### Step 4: Bump the shared library

Okay, almost there. Tag `brimkit-ui` with the new minor version, then update the version pin in each consumer's lockfile — the release bot handles all but the two legacy apps. Before cutting the release, record the new version in the component registry table, which lives in the database reachable via the string below.

primary connection of yagep-kahip = redis://giliel_svc:zYiKsLL2PLpfPL@db-348f.xolmarsys.corp:5432/fenwyn

### Capacity note: Quillbox puzzle generation

Quillbox's generator is CPU-bound during grid fill, and peak demand arrives in bursts when the Sunday batch kicks off. At current wordlist size, each 15x15 fill averages 2.1s with a long tail near 30s on sparse themes. We propose capping concurrent fills per worker and queueing overflow rather than scaling pods reactively. The proposed limits and queue bounds are listed below.

tuning table, yajog-faduf:
QUOTAS = {
    "briir": 907,
    "novys": 314,
    "holius": 831,
    "jorir": 657,
    "zorys": 972,
}

Test-plan note — Transcode Farm (Murkwater cluster)

Before you green-light the release, we need a full pass on the Pellicle transcoding farm: spin up twenty parallel jobs, mix of 4K and vertical clips, and confirm none of the workers starve on the new scheduler. Also check that failed jobs requeue instead of vanishing — that bit us last cycle. Dashboards are in the usual spot. To kick off the load-test suite against the farm's control API, use the token below.

session JWT of yawep-yawep = eyJhbGciOiJIUzI1NiIsInR5cCI6IkpXVCJ9.eyJzdWIiOiI3pWF3_In0.aXYsHiog

Ticket #—Facilities, Orbel Group. Heads up: while the Denner Street lobby is torn up, reception moves to the temporary cabin by the east car park. It's basic but heated, promise. Post and couriers should be redirected there from Monday. The cabin door has a keypad instead of the usual badge reader, so don't wave your pass at it like I did. To get in, punch in the code below.

door code, kawip-bagap: bdg-HQEWH-4